    Christabel is an unfinished poem of 677 lines written by S.T. Coleridge. Its first part consists of 337 lines‚ which was written in 1797 and its second part consists of 337 lines which were written in 1800‚ after Coleridge returned back from Germany. After this there was a decline in his poetic powers and in spite of his numerous efforts to complete the poem‚ he could not do so.     REPORT ON SURROUNDING VILLAGES OF BANDHAVGARH NATIONAL PARK Bandhavgarh National Park lies at the geographical centre of India. It is said to be a heaven for Tigers and other wildlife. Declared as a Tiger Reserve in 1993‚ Bandhavgarh holds the highest density of Tigers in India. Off late there have been some cases of poisoning of Tigers as retaliation by the local villagers but still the King roams freely in and around Bandhavgarh.
